About Sachin Kadian

Sachin Kadian is a scholar working on Pharmaceutical Science, Bioengineering, Biophysics, Biomedical Engineering and Materials Chemistry, having authored 47 papers that have together received 1.5k indexed citations. Recurring topics across this work include Carbon and Quantum Dots Applications (12 papers), Electrochemical sensors and biosensors (10 papers), Graphene and Nanomaterials Applications (9 papers), Nanocluster Synthesis and Applications (7 papers), Advancements in Transdermal Drug Delivery (7 papers), Advanced biosensing and bioanalysis techniques (6 papers), Conducting polymers and applications (6 papers) and Gas Sensing Nanomaterials and Sensors (4 papers). The work is most often cited by research in Pharmaceutical Science (164 citations), Materials Chemistry (805 citations), Biomedical Engineering (638 citations), Bioengineering (81 citations) and Biophysics (78 citations). Sachin Kadian has collaborated with scholars based in United States, India and Canada. Frequent co-authors include Gaurav Manik, Ashish Kalkal, P. Gopinath, Rangadhar Pradhan, R. P. Chauhan, Sushanta K. Sethi, Shubhangi Shukla, Partha Roy, Roger J. Narayan and Rahim Rahimi. Their work appears in journals such as Journal of Materials Chemistry B, Applied Physics Reviews, ACS Applied Bio Materials, ACS Applied Materials & Interfaces and MRS Communications.
